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Repair

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ant smells can show hidden water sources or mold growth in your home.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ause floors to warp or buckle making it difficult to walk or use the space.

Discoloration or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water damage can leave unsightly st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ings.

Visible Water Leaks or Stains

Don’t ignore visible water leaks or stains they can lead to bigger problems if left unchecked.

Unexplained Increases in Your Water Bill

A sudden spike in your water bill can show hidden water leaks or damaged pipes in your home.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Water damage can lead to mold or mildew growth which can be hazardous to your health.

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No DIY fixes are usually enough for small leaks.
Large flood or storm damage No Yes Professional help is needed to extract water and dry your home quickly and efficiently.
Hidden water source or mold growth No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to detect and fix hidden water sources or mold growth.
Water damage to electrical or HVAC systems No Yes Electrical or HVAC systems need spec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ely and correctly.
Water damage to structural elements (e.g. Walls, floors) No Yes Structural elements need professional repair to ensure your home remains safe and secure.

Water Damage Repair Cost In Ponchatoula, LA

The cost of Water Damage Repair in Ponchatoula, LA, can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on industry averages and may not reflect your specific situation. Free estimates are available upon request.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water, equipment needed
Sanitization and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of sanitizing agents used
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and the specific services required for your situation. Free estimates are available upon request.

Q: What causes water damage in homes?

A: Water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, burst pipes, clogged gutters, and appliance malfunctions.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ent water damage.
